#c7f5c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c7f5c2 is composed of 78% red, 96.1%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.8%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 114.1 degrees, a saturation of 71.8% and a lightness of 86.1%. #c7f5c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8feb85.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#c7f5c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c7f5c2 has RGB values of R:199, G:245,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0.21,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 13104578.
